The Employed Person's Allowance has come into force in the Isle of Man today (Tuesday).
It replaces Family Income Supplement and Disability Working Allowance.
EPA will continue to give financial support to people on low incomes and rates of allowance will not change.
The Department of Social Care says the new benefit will be less costly to run, as it will create less bureaucracy.
